Same-day campus delivery directly impacts the efficiency of engineering processes by ensuring that critical components and materials are available precisely when needed. This JIT (Just-In-Time) delivery model minimizes downtime and reduces the need for extensive on-site storage, thereby streamlining operations and reducing costs.
In a high-stakes environment like semiconductor FABs or EV manufacturing facilities, where a delay of mere hours can translate into significant financial losses, the reliability of same-day delivery becomes paramount. It ensures that engineers can proceed with their work without interruption, maintaining the momentum necessary for rapid project completion.

Utilizing Foreign-Trade Zones (FTZs) can further enhance the benefits of same-day delivery. FTZs allow for the storage, exhibition, assembly, manufacturing, and processing of both domestic and foreign merchandise, often with significant tax and duty savings. By integrating same-day delivery within FTZ operations, Infrastructure Deployment Managers can optimize their supply chain while maintaining compliance with international trade laws.
